The story behind the image
Our scenic flight across the Sossusvlei Dunes was full of exciting views, and the dunes were most certainly the highlight.
This photo shows the beginning of a dune on the southern side of the main road through the Sossusvlei. The late afternoon sun was casting long shadows already, dipping the eastern side of the dune into dark shadow. The little dots at the border of the dune are trees. This puts the enormous size of the dune into perspective.
